... Read moreFrom my personal experience exploring Amazon FBA (Fulfillment by Amazon), I've found that understanding the supply chain is crucial for success. Many sellers import goods, often from China, where products can be sourced at a low cost—sometimes as low as $0.55 per item—allowing competitive pricing on the Amazon marketplace. One effective approach is to partner with OEM factories to create private label products, which gives sellers unique branding power and can drive higher profit margins. When selling on Amazon, the system handles warehousing, shipping, and even customer service, which means sellers can focus on marketing and product selection. I also found that choosing products with steady demand, such as health and wellness items like inhalers featuring essential oils (e.g., menthol, spearmint, lavender), can be very profitable. These natural ingredient-based products are popular among customers seeking wellness boosts. Additionally, Amazon’s affiliate program (Amazon Afiliados) offers another revenue stream. By promoting products through affiliate links, individuals can earn commissions without holding inventory. For anyone looking to scale their operations, understanding these facets—product sourcing, private labeling, Amazon FBA logistics, and affiliate marketing—is key.
